Review: North Stars Sirius 31 Year Old

North Stars Sirius 31 Year Old

Cask Info: Matured in ex-Bourbon casks.

North Stars Sirius 31 Year Old

Nose: Bright and fresh. Up front are notes of green apple, honeydew melon, and unripe banana. I also get butter cookies, marzipan, and citrus oil (leaning toward mandarin orange). Time reveals vanilla icing and hints of old leather. It’s softly sweet.


Palate: Sweeter than I’d expected from the nose, with a slightly creamy mouthfeel. Honey, hazelnut chocolate, hot cocoa, and apricot.


Finish: Medium-to-long finish, with a balanced mix of sweetness, bitterness, and a gentle burn.


Final Thought: For an old whisky, it is unexpectedly fresh. The sweet notes, along with the low cask-strength, make this whisky very approachable. Although I find the nose more complex than the taste, the flavors do hold up over time and offer that classic Scotch appeal. Personally, I think the price is too steep for the taste but reasonable for the age. On that note, this would be a great gift if you want to impress someone. I mean, who wouldn’t go 😍😍😍 for a 31-year-old whisky?!


Girl with Cask Strength Score: 86/100.
